java作为编程最火的一门编程说话,在火速开辟上具有很年夜的优势,java架构师是每一个java开辟手艺方面的追求,小编作为一名已经从事5年java开辟的人员对怎么当作为java架构师有以下看法
首先是根本,在当作为java架构师之前首先你需如果一个java高级工程师,对java的各类实现道理要比力明白,对各类微办事、缓存手艺、各类分布式架构都要领会其底层道理
若是你已经达到了java高级工程师,那么下面你需要养当作一个好的习惯-----读源码,架构师需要领会架构之间的机能、营业处置体例等
对于数据布局和算法需要做到精晓,本家儿要有哈希表、优化算法、数组、链表等算法,如许才能做出机能较高的架构
java架构师需要精晓linux,因为近似于nginx如许的东西必需要在Linux下设置装备摆设办事,所以这是必备
需要把握分布式存储系统,领会分布式存储系统的优错误谬误以及他们的利用场景
领会了上面的仍是不敷的,架构师需要有很强的营业处置能力,理解产物部分给出的需求,领会客户的需求,按照客户的需求搭建最完美、最有用、最贴合的高质量架构
0 篇文章
如果觉得我的文章对您有用,请随意打赏。你的支持将鼓励我继续创作!